Common Mental Disorders: socio-demographic and pharmacotherapy profile1 1 Supported by Conselho Nacional de Desenvolvimento Científico e Tecnológico (CNPq), process # 478814/2012-7

Abstracts

OBJECTIVE:

this study reports an association between Common Mental Disorders and the socio-demographic and pharmacotherapy profiles of 106 patients cared for by a Primary Health Care unit in the interior of São Paulo, Brazil.

METHOD:

this is a cross-sectional descriptive exploratory study with a quantitative approach. Structured interviews and validated instruments were used to collect data. The Statistical Package for Social Science was used for analysis.

RESULTS:

The prevalence of Common Mental Disorders was 50%. An association was found between Common Mental Disorders and the variables occupation, family income, number of prescribed medications and number of pills taken a day. Greater therapy non-adherence was observed among those who tested positive for Common Mental Disorders.

CONCLUSION:

this study's results show the importance of health professionals working in PHC to be able to detect needs of a psychological nature among their patients and to support the implementation of actions to prevent the worsening of Common Mental Disorders.

Introduction

Research has been conducted around the world to assess the occurrence and impact of Common Mental Disorders (CMD). The concept of CMDs characterizes cases that present non-psychotic symptoms, such as insomnia, fatigue, nervousness, headaches, depressive symptoms, irritability, forgetfulness, difficulty concentrating, and non-specific symptoms that lead to functional incapacity but do not meet the requirements of diagnoses listed in the Diagnostic and Statistical Manual of Mental Disorders (DSM-IV)( 11. Method

This cross-sectional descriptive-exploratory study with a quantitative approach was developed in a PHC unit in a city in the interior of São Paulo, Brazil. It proceeded after approval was obtained from the Institutional Review Board (Protocol 1474/2011) and participants signed free and informed consent forms in accordance with Resolution 196/96, National Health Code. The sample was composed of 106 patients with medical appointments in this PHC unit scheduled, from May to July, 2012. The following equation was used to compute sample size:

Where P represents the prevalence of the studied event, z α/2 represents the level of significance adopted and ε refers to acceptable sampling error. The acceptable sampling error was 5% and the level of significance was set at 5%. A non-response rate of 15% was considered. Inclusion criteria were being 18 years old or older, being able to communicate verbally in Portuguese, and having an appointment scheduled in the PHC unit (medical or gynecology and obstetric clinics). Exclusion criteria were: attending the service exclusively to use the pharmacy, or for bandages or vaccines (without a medical appointment), being younger than 18 years of age, and being unable to communicate verbally. A pre-test was performed in the study's setting to check whether the instrument's content and form would achieve the proposed objectives. Patients interviewed in the pre-test were not included in the sample.

During data collection, the researchers remained in the research setting every day, for alternate hours, in order to cover the entire unit's office hours. Hence, the patients were approached while they waited for their medical consultations and, if they agreed, interviews were then performed in a private room within the unit itself or their names and addresses were taken to schedule an interview in their homes, if preferred.

A structured interview guided by a script was used to ensure all the participants were asked the same questions. The script contained questions regarding the patients' socio-demographic and pharmacotherapy profile. The participants' medical charts were checked later to correctly identify the prescribed medications and minimize errors.

The SRQ-20 is a dichotomous scale composed of 20 questions in which each affirmative answer scores one and comprises the total score. Individuals who answer "yes" to eight or more questions are considered to test positive for CMDs( 1111. Mari JJ. Williams PA. Psicol Saúde & Doenças. 2001;2(2):81-100. ). This test is composed of seven questions. The first is "Have you ever forgotten to take medications?" A Likert scale from 1 to 6 is used for each question. A score of 1 corresponds to "always" (indicating low adherence) and a score of 6 corresponds to "never" (indicating high adherence). The score of each answer is totaled and then divided by the number of questions. Those patients who scored from 1 to 4 on the AMT, that is, checked the answers "always", "almost always", "frequently", and "sometimes," were considered to be non-adherent, while those who scored 5 and 6, which indicate answers "rarely" and "never," respectively, were considered to be adherent.

A quantitative approach was used in the data analysis. Data were analyzed using the Statistical Package for the Social Sciences (SPSS, version 17.0). Statistical associations were found between the study's variables using Fisher's exact test, while the hypothesis of association was accepted when p was equal or below 0.05.

Results

Characterization of the study's participants and Common Mental Disorders

Participants were 106 users of a PHC unit in the interior of São Paulo, Brazil. The sample was mainly composed of women (88.7%) while the average age of patients was 40 years old, ranging from 18 to 68 years old. Table 1 shows that half of the interviewed patients (50%) tested positive for CMDs. CMDs were associated with the variables occupation (p<0.01) and family income (p=0.05). The prevalence of CMDs was greater among unemployed (64.7%) and retired (85.7%) individuals. There was also a trend for CMDs to be associated with level of education (p=0.06).

Table 1
Prevalence of Common Mental Disorders according to socio-demographic and economic variables. Ribeirão Preto, SP, Brazil, 2012

Pharmacotherapy Profile and Common Mental Disorders

In regard to the medications used by the participants (Table 2) that are listed in the Anatomical Therapeutic Chemical Classification System (ATC) adopted by the World Health Organization, the following are usually used for high blood pressure and were present in 25% of the prescriptions: C09 (Agent acting on the renin-angiotensin system), C03 (Diuretics) and C07A (Beta blocking agents). We note that 12.9% of the prescriptions were in the N06A classification (antidepressants) and N05B (anxiolytics), while all anxiolytics were benzodiazepines.

Table 2
Distribution of medications used by the study's participants according to the Anatomical Therapeutic Chemical Classification System and the presence of Common Mental Disorders. Ribeirão Preto, SP, Brazil, 2012

The patients testing positive for CMDs comprised the majority of prescriptions, in general. Additionally, an association (p<0.01) between the use of psychotropic medications and CMDs was found. We observed that 90.9% of Antidepressants (N06A) and 83.3% of Anxiolytics (N05B) were prescribed for patients who tested positive for CMDs.

Table 3 shows an association between the presence of CMDs and the pharmacotherapy variables "use of medications" (p=0.05), "number of prescribed medications" (p=0.034) and "number of pills taken a day" (p=0.036).

Table 3
Prevalence of Common Mental Disorders according to variables related to the patients' pharmacotherapy profile. Ribeirão Preto, SP, Brazil, 2012

Medication adherence

In regard to medication adherence, the number of patients who responded to the AMT (48) is greater than the number of patients considered to have used the medications previously described (43). Such a difference is due to the fact that five patients reported the use of ongoing medications and for this reason they answered the AMT. However, their medical files did not list any medications and we opted to use data from the medical files instead in order to minimize errors.

Therefore, 27.1% of the patients were considered to be non-adherent to medication according to the AMT. Additionally, in regard to the number of types of medications, we observed that patients with more than three types of prescribed medications had a higher percentage of adherence (76.2%) when compared to those who had up to two types of medications prescribed (54.5%). The same occurred with the number of pills taken a day: greater adherence (78.6%) was observed among patients taking three or more pills a day, when compared to patients taking up to two pills a day (40%). Such differences, however, were not found to be significant according to Fisher's test (p=0.99).

The statistical analysis did not show any association between CMDs and medication adherence (p=0.52). Nonetheless, 69% of the patients who tested positive for CMDs adhered to their medication, while this percentage was higher (78.9%) among those who tested negative for CMDs.

Discussion

Analysis of the patients' socio-demographic profiles revealed that most individuals were female. One of the inclusion criteria was having a medical appointment in the unit's medical specialties, including gynecologic and obstetrics. Such an aspect might, in part, explain this finding. Because this is a cross-sectional study, causal relationships cannot be established among the observed associations. However, the theory of stress-producing events and the theory of social roles and social support have been established for years as explanations for socioeconomic indicators and CMDs( 2727. Conclusions

The association of CMDs with socioeconomic variables reaffirms the view that the presence of these disorders is strongly linked to social disadvantage. Also, the results of this study reveal a sample of patients with a high prevalence of CMDs and a high level of use of medication and also the unsafe use of medications, given the association of CMDs and pharmacotherapy variables with lower therapy adherence among patients with CMDs.

We note that a large part of the medications prescribed are for organic diseases, thus patients do not receive care appropriate to their profiles, which also include complaints of a psychological order. From this perspective, this study's results show the importance of health professionals working in PHC being prepared to detect psychological complaints among the population to which they provide care. It is also necessary to reflect upon the education of health professional in the psychiatric field who are usually found only in specialized services, which may hinder the adoption of the biopsychosocial health concept in clinical practice.

Further research, especially population-based longitudinal studies, is needed to better understand the associations found and provide insights that strengthen mental health care within the PHC sphere.
